Strategies for Enhancing Efficiency and Fairness in the Court System

Welcome to our guide on enhancing harmony in the court system through strategies for efficiency and fairness.

Efficiency and fairness are crucial elements in maintaining a functioning and just court system. Below are some key strategies that can help achieve this goal:

  • Case Management: Implementing efficient case management techniques can help streamline the court process. This includes setting realistic timelines, managing court calendars effectively, and encouraging alternative dispute resolution methods like mediation.
  • Technology Integration: Embracing technology can greatly enhance efficiency in the court system. Electronic filing systems, virtual hearings, and online portals for case updates can reduce delays and paperwork, making the process smoother for all involved parties.
  • Transparency and Accountability: Maintaining transparency in court proceedings and decisions fosters trust in the judicial system. Judges and court personnel should be held accountable for their actions, ensuring fairness and integrity in every case.
  • Training and Education: Continuous training for judges, lawyers, and court staff is essential to keep up with evolving legal practices and technologies. Well-trained professionals can handle cases more efficiently and make fair judgments based on the law.
  • Access to Justice: Ensuring equal access to justice for all individuals is fundamental for a fair court system. Providing legal aid services, interpreters for non-English speakers, and accommodations for individuals with disabilities promotes fairness and inclusivity.

By incorporating these strategies into the court system, we can work towards a more efficient, fair, and harmonious legal process for everyone involved.

The Top 5 Factors That Impact Court Decisions

Welcome to our guide on the key factors that play a significant role in shaping court decisions. Understanding these factors can provide valuable insight into the legal process and help you navigate the complexities of the court system. Below are the top 5 factors that influence court decisions:

  1. Evidence: The cornerstone of any court case is the evidence presented. Strong, credible evidence that supports a party’s claims can heavily impact the outcome of a case. The quality and admissibility of evidence can sway a judge or jury in favor of one party over another.
  2. Legal Precedent: Legal precedent refers to previous court decisions that are considered authoritative and can serve as a guide in similar cases. Courts often look to established legal principles and past rulings to ensure consistency and fairness in their decisions.
  3. Legal Interpretation: The interpretation of laws, statutes, and regulations can vary among judges and courts. Different interpretations of the law can lead to divergent outcomes in similar cases, highlighting the importance of legal argumentation and persuasive reasoning.
  4. Judicial Discretion: Judges have discretionary powers to make decisions based on their judgment and interpretation of the law. Judicial discretion allows judges to consider the specific circumstances of each case and tailor their rulings accordingly.
  5. Public Policy Considerations: Courts may take into account public policy concerns when making decisions that have broader societal implications. Balancing legal principles with public interests is crucial in promoting justice and maintaining harmony in the court system.

By recognizing the significance of these factors, individuals can better comprehend the intricacies of court decisions and engage more effectively with the legal process. Top Challenges Confronting the Court System: A Comprehensive Analysis

Enhancing Harmony in the Court System

In order to achieve harmony in the court system, it is crucial to identify and address the top challenges that confront the system. These challenges, if left unattended, can hinder the efficient functioning of the courts and impede the delivery of justice. Below are some key challenges that are commonly faced by the court system:

  • Backlog of Cases: One of the primary challenges facing the court system is the backlog of cases. Due to various factors such as resource constraints, increased litigation, and procedural delays, courts often struggle to keep up with the influx of cases. This backlog not only delays the resolution of disputes but also increases costs for all parties involved.
  • Resource Constraints: Insufficient funding and resources pose a significant challenge to the effective functioning of the court system. Courts require adequate staffing, technology, and infrastructure to operate efficiently. Without proper resources, courts may face delays in processing cases, leading to a backlog and inefficiencies in the system.
  • Access to Justice: Ensuring access to justice for all individuals, regardless of their background or financial status, is a fundamental challenge for the court system. Limited access to legal representation, language barriers, and complex legal procedures can hinder individuals from seeking justice through the courts. Addressing these barriers is essential to enhancing harmony in the court system.
  • Technology Integration: Embracing technology is crucial for modernizing the court system and improving overall efficiency. However, many courts struggle with outdated technology systems, which can result in delays, errors, and security vulnerabilities. Integrating technology effectively into court processes is essential for enhancing harmony and accessibility.
  • Judicial Independence: Preserving judicial independence is vital for upholding the rule of law and ensuring fair and impartial decisions. Challenges such as political interference, external pressures, and lack of judicial autonomy can threaten the independence of the judiciary. Safeguarding judicial independence is essential for maintaining trust in the court system.
  • By addressing these top challenges confronting the court system, stakeholders can work towards enhancing harmony, improving efficiency, and ultimately delivering justice effectively. It is imperative for all involved parties to collaborate and implement solutions to overcome these challenges and strengthen the court system for the benefit of society as a whole.
